From the Guardian
Revealing the details behind the decision to shift the focus of the investigation onto the McCanns, the source said that in addition to the blood at the holiday flat, DNA evidence had been found in a car rented by the McCanns more than two weeks after Madeleine went missing.
He said that while both samples had matched Madeleine's DNA, since they had degraded over time, this was based on an incomplete picture - only 15 of the available 20 genetic markers usually used for such analysis were found: 'Nineteen out of 20 is what we consider conclusive. In this case, they could extract only 15 - but all of the 15 exactly matched Madeleine's DNA.' He also dismissed as 'simply wrong' recent media reports that blood had been found in the car.
He said the Portuguese police were taking the sample recovered from the flat seriously - in part because of 'contradictions and changes' in the accounts given by the McCanns and their friends of what happened the night Madeleine disappeared.

That statement doesn't make any sense to me either. Sounds like something from the Sun. Usually time of death is calculated by looking at the state of internal organs, and the type of bacteria and/or insects that are currently 'working' on the body. You might be able to get a very, very vague idea of the time the blood left the body via decomposition, but I very much doubt you can tell whether the person was dead or not at the time. I very much doubt DNA comes into it at any level, bar identification.
